Riad Mur Akush is located in the authentic and prestigious quarter of Bab Doukkala, within 10 minutes of the famous Jemaa El Fna and easily accessible by car.

The Riad offers large and comfortable rooms and bathrooms (all air-conditioned) and plenty of common areas to enjoy peace and tranquility, after a day in the enchanting souks of Marrakech. The heart of the house beats in its patio, a large area with a wonderful feature: a magnificent fountain, which cools the house and calms the senses with its gentle murmur. The two salons cater for different moods; one is mysterious and traditional, ideal for a quiet drink or some relaxing music, the other one light and airy with an inviting fireplace and sociable seating. Our terraces offer wonderfull views over the Medina and the Altas Mountains, preferred spot for an evening drink under the stars, or breakfast under the blue sky.

To ensure you have a special stay, our capable team will organise anything for you (a special meal cooked by our in house cook, a day in a hammam, a special party) and our experienced guide will advise and plan customised trips for you (day trips to Essaouira, hiking trips to the Atlas, trips in the Sahara).

Due to its traditional architecture, the Riad is not always a very safe place for small children; although we welcome our young guests with much enthusiasm, please note that the safety of your children will be your responsibility.
